- person density
- Measure density of names by comparing density of common name elements (bin/bint) to density of common, unambiguous names (Muhammad, Ahmad, etc.). If possible also compare with names tagged from OA name list.
- Tag names from OA list. Tag each element separately (Abu Ali, Ahmad, b. Ibrahim). Then combine adjacent or tag certainty of persName based on adjacency.
- Turn name list into HTML and use Alpheos to check for names that are common words. Use this to label persName certainty.
- Check accuracy of above methods on samples. Also provide ratio of name element occurrence (bin/bint) to actual name density using samples. E.g., occurrence of 10 bin/bint implies 7 persons, i.e. multiply bin/bint occurrence by 0.7.

- interreligious density
- Use labels from OA plus additional keywords (church, bishop, synagogue, etc.) to measure density, esp. of affiliations different from author's own.
- Check above against samples (and perhaps tweak keywords accordingly.)
